BANGALORE: A 68-year-old teacher, who allegedly raped a fifth standard student and threatened to murder her, was arrested by K R Puram police. Irked by the incident, the victim’s family members and public ransacked the school. The accused Krishnamurthy, was teaching Mathematics, Science and Sanskrit at KNSS School at Anandapuram. He is a retired ITI employee residing at ITI Layout. It is alleged that the accused raped the 12-year-old girl for the last one month.

The police said that the incident came to light when the girl’s mother grew suspicious about the victim’s behaviour who had fallen ill.

K R Puram police have registered a case.

Mother Kills Kid, Self

A woman fed poison and killed her three-and-a-half-year-old daughter and  ended life by consuming it at her residence in Bhadrappa Layout on Tuesday. The deceased are Hemavathi, 33, and Yukta. She was married to Rangaswamy, a mechanic, for seven years. The police said that Rangaswamy had gone to work and the incident came to light when he returned home.

A suicide note by Hemavathi states she is responsible for her death
